This memorable piece of architecture, built in 1937, replaces an earlier church from 1910. Jacob Maydanyk created some of the icons within. The dome is open to the inside bringing in light that creates a space that enriches the spirit.

Construction on this municipal heritage site began in 1935. The style is reminiscent of Quebec parish churches of the 1800s.
